What is Open Enrollment?
Open enrollment, also known as School Choice, is Wisconsin's public school program which allows parents to apply for their children to attend school in a school district other than the one in which they live. If parents already have a child attending a school district through open enrollment, they must apply for each additional child in their family as they become eligible.
Who May Participate?
Students in 5-Year Old Kindergarten through Grade 12 and who are Wisconsin residents.

How and When May Parents Apply?
The recommended method of applying for open enrollment is through the on-line application process on the Department of Public Instruction's website (http://sms.dpi.wi.gov/sms_psctoc) during the open enrollment application period. Parents may complete a paper application and submit it to the district they wish for their child to attend (non-resident school district) during the application period. The application period for the 2013-14 school year will open at midnight on February 4, 2013 and close at 4:00 pm on April 30, 2013.
